Dhaka, Aug. 17 -- The Financial Express editor, Shamsul Huq Zahid, has underscored the importance of addressing logistics challenges to boost Bangladesh's export performance.

"If we can reduce logistics expenses by 25 per cent, our exports could grow by 20 per cent," he told a roundtable titled "Challenges, Opportunities, and Way Forward in Shipping & Logistics Landscape" at the Lakeshore Heights Hotel in Dhaka's Gulshan on Sunday.

He noted that although logistics is a significant issue, it receives little attention.

Mr Zahid acknowledged that not all stakeholders could be accommodated in the present roundtable and said the newspaper was considering organising a larger event on the issue in the future.
